Shifts Melanin production toward Pheomelanin There are two main types of melanin in the skin: Eumelanin (dark brown/black pigment) Pheomelanin (light red/yellow pigment) Glutathione influences the balance, encouraging your skin to produce more pheomelanin, resulting in a brighter, more luminous tone especially in individuals with melanin-rich or unevenly pigmented skin
